Early voting for August election starts Friday
Tullahoma residents will be able to make their voices heard as the early voting period for the Aug. 6 election is set to begin this Friday, July 17, and will conclude on Friday, Aug. 1.

Cody Campbell named Regional General Manager
The Middle Tennessee newspapers under Lakeway Publishers are seeing a change in leadership as Cody Campbell was named the Regional General Manager for The Tullahoma News, The Manchester Times and The Moore County News.

Braves organist is most valuable player
Atlanta Braves fans are familiar with the names Matt Olson, Ozzie Albies, and Chris Sale. These are among the many All-Star players we cheer for at Truist Park 81 games a year. All of those guys get plenty of media coverage, becoming household names among baseball fans. But there are so many people off the field who deserve our praise as well. From the parking lot attendants, to the food workers, ushers, security officers and more. I can’t leave out the video, radio, and social media crew, the in-game entertainment staff, world-class TV broadcaster Brandon Gaudin, and opera singer Timothy Miller, who delivers perfect renditions of “God Bless America” at Sunday home games.

Sweet as Honey
As many of you know, my Papa Billy Allen, is known around town as the “Honey Man”. His dedication to preserving honeybees in Moore County and the countless hours he has spent with bees is admirable. As his granddaughter, it has become hard for me to not also want to be involved in the honey production side of agriculture.
